Wilsons Promontory is a pretty large national park on the southernmost tip of the Aus mainland. We got there pretty late the first night and camped up at Tidal River. The next day we organised our packs and set out on and 18k hike to Refuge Cove. Camped over night there and then another 17k hike loop back to Telegraph car park. 35k in total. Have never hiked that much and it was tough with our tents and everything on our backs. There were some runners there that were running a 100k in 24hrs, crazy! They started and 6:30am and would finish 2-3am the next day! I can think of better things to do :).
